Gonna state the obvious but the guidelines of b3 (and brackets generally) are broad enough that there’s still a wide range of power within them and also specific enough to produce a bell curve of power within each bracket around a fairly expected average power/explosiveness/speed/oppressiveness. The high end of any bracket is going to be lists that are high synergy, high interaction, optimized land packages, etc.

You’ve got a pretty strong list (I like the clones angle) with all of above plus some mid-high power tutors/GCs. In my experience, most other b3 decks aim to do less powerful things, do their thing less well, slower, or offer less resistance, but Kefka and the cards he encourages also just kinda skew strong and interaction-y (displacer kitten OP). No clear red flags but EDH is all about experience (both you and the table which you clearly appreciate. Different draw engines, swapping some interaction and tutor slots for another sub theme or pet cards, or adding some proactive protection vs reactive can make a big difference in how it feels but you’re not misrepresenting anything

I really enjoy my [[Kenessos, Priest of Thassa]] deck in part this reason—he also seems similar to Sigarda so might be fun to look at!

Kenny is 2 mana so he never feels bad to recast, his activated ability can flood the board with creatures mid-late game post-wipe (especially when you can hit an ability discount or an untap lands at endstep effects) several of the sea monsters you can cheat out have unique/fun disruption and protection effects like [[Serpent of Yawning Depths]] as well as a few one-sided mass removal options like [[Summon: Leviathan]] and [[Whelming Wave]]. He loves having access to cheap blue cantrips and counterspells, you’ve got [[heroic intervention]] and weirder options like [[Kira, great glass spinner]] and [[Dawnglade Regent]] that might find a place in what you’re building too.

People connect and maintain friendships in different ways. I'm 24, graduated college, and have had similar challenges staying connected with some of my best friends/roommates. However, they just visited for the first time in 2 years last week and, similarly, we picked up where we left off and things felt very comfortable.

Sounds like you're not receiving the reciprocal effort you need to feel like you're in a balanced friendship but if this connection actually matters to you, I think it's important he knows this is how youre feeling about your dynamic. So, talk to him. Don't need to lay the guilt on, but say that you're in new phases of life, that he was an important connection you'd be interested in and have shown interest in maintaining, but that the way things are now aren't really doing it for you and probably aren't sustainable. Gotta be clear with your friends what you need in a friendship--some people don't want to know or share the gory personal details and want a more casual, surface level connection too even if they still think you're great. I'd probably swap x speeds for leaf since you're really only intending on retreating dialga and you'd like to preserve the energy as much as possible imo. The Cyrus plus poke flute plus giant cape plus Dawn is a lot going on. IMO, pokeflute is meant to buff your damage so you don't need to switch things out using Cyrus. Even then, rarely do people use two poke flutes in a game as you usually knock out one basic and one EX or two EXes. Most Pigeot decks I've seen only run one flute.

IMO, cut Cyrus and one flute for two poke communicators to try and piece your line together faster and Leaf to preserve Dialga energy. I like the giant cape preserve and the thought to Dawn up an energy to Dialga from the bench so it 'powers itself' in a way
